لطفا جهت اطلاع از آخرین دوره ها و اخبار سایت در
کانال تلگرام
عضو شوید.
برنامه نویسی واکنشی جاوا اسکریپت [ویدئو]
Reactive JavaScript Programming [Video]
نکته:
آخرین آپدیت رو دریافت میکنید حتی اگر این محتوا بروز نباشد.
نمونه ویدیوها:
توضیحات دوره:
این ویدیو ترکیبی از سه جنبه زیر است:
? مقدمه ای بر برنامه نویسی واکنشی + Rx در عمق.
? نیاز به واکنشپذیری، درک جریانهای رویداد، آشنایی با APIها و ساختن یک برنامه محاسبهگر BMI.
? مفاهیم Rx و API های مشابه را در بسیاری از زبان ها، پوشش عملگرهای لازم، نمونه هایی از اپراتورها و جریان ها، معرفی کنید.
? ساخت اپلیکیشن کرونومتر
? ساخت کادر جستجوی تکمیل خودکار با Rx.
? ایجاد عملگرها و انجام عملیات های مختلف مانند تبدیل، فیلتر، ترکیب و مدیریت خطا.
? قدرت و سهولت استفاده از برنامه نویسی Reactive
? تفکر و مدل سازی اپلیکیشن ها به روش واکنشی.
? Rx js را از جمله عملگرها، موضوعات و زمانبندیکنندهها کاملاً درک کنید.
? این دوره فرض می کند که بینندگان حداقل کمی با JS در مرورگرها و Node آشنا هستند.
? برخی از دانش ES6 فرض می شود که حدود 1.5 سال است که وجود داشته است، اما این دوره در ابتدا از طریق نحو ES6 هدایت می شود.
• مدیریت یک جریان نامحدود از داده های ورودی با استفاده از RxJs * • اپراتور مهم RxJs را کاوش کنید * • با اپراتورها آشنا شوید *
سرفصل ها و درس ها
برنامه نویسی واکنشی جاوا اسکریپت
Reactive JavaScript Programming
بررسی اجمالی دوره
The Course Overview
نیاز به واکنش نشان دادن
The Need for Going Reactive
اولین گاز به bacon.js
First Bite into bacon.js
ساخت یک اپلیکیشن واکنشی
Building a Reactive Application
بازی خود را با Rx ارتقا دهید
Up Your Game with Rx
قرار دادن Rx در Context
Putting Rx in Context
برخورد با اپراتورها
Dealing with Operators
بازی با استریمز
Playing with Streams
Rx روز به روز
Day-to-Day Rx
ساخت اپلیکیشن کرونومتر
Building a Stopwatch Application
پیاده سازی Drag and Drop
Implementing Drag and Drop
اپراتورهای خود را بشناسید
Know Your Operators
اپراتورها را ایجاد کنید
Create Operators
اپراتورهای تبدیل
Transform Operators
اپراتورهای فیلتر
Filter Operators
اپراتورها را ترکیب کنید
Combine Operators
اپراتورهای رسیدگی به خطا
Error Handling Operators
روی Control App کلیک کنید
Click Control App
مشاهده پذیرهای خود را بسازید
Make Your Own Observables
مشاهده پذیرها به عنوان توابع
Observables as Functions
رسیدگی و تکمیل خطا
Error Handling and Completion
افزودن اپراتور Creation
Adding the Creation Operator
Packtpub یک ناشر دیجیتالی کتابها و منابع آموزشی در زمینه فناوری اطلاعات و توسعه نرمافزار است. این شرکت از سال 2004 فعالیت خود را آغاز کرده و به تولید و انتشار کتابها، ویدیوها و دورههای آموزشی میپردازد که به توسعهدهندگان و متخصصان فناوری اطلاعات کمک میکند تا مهارتهای خود را ارتقا دهند. منابع آموزشی Packtpub موضوعات متنوعی از جمله برنامهنویسی، توسعه وب، دادهکاوی، امنیت سایبری و هوش مصنوعی را پوشش میدهد. محتوای این منابع به صورت کاربردی و بهروز ارائه میشود تا کاربران بتوانند دانش و تواناییهای لازم برای موفقیت در پروژههای عملی و حرفهای خود را کسب کنند.
Shriyans Bhatnagar از RX.js به صورت روزانه در محل کار استفاده می کند و بیشتر آن را با React و Redux ترکیب می کند. او بهعنوان یک توسعهدهنده فول استک، اغلب متوجه میشود که از RX در Node نیز استفاده میکند. در حالی که با چند کتابخانه واکنشپذیر مانند RXjs، most.js، و bacon.js و چارچوبهای Reactive مانند cycle.js بازی میکند، او کاملاً عاشق نوشتن کدهای Reactive عملکردی است. او از طرفداران پرشور برنامه نویسی تابعی خالص است. او به طور گسترده با هاسکل، نارون و ارلنگ بازی کرده است و تجربه ای در نوشتن clojureScript دارد. این روزها او وارد ReasonML (یک رابط جدید برای OCaml توسط فیس بوک) شده است. او بهعنوان یک مهندس باطن شروع به نوشتن برنامههای Ruby با استفاده از Rails کرد، اما به سرعت به استفاده از جاوا اسکریپت برای بکاند و فرانتاند ادامه داد. سرگرمی های او از ساخت ربات های Node-powered با استفاده از Johnny-Five با آردوینو تا پروژه های یادگیری ماشینی با استفاده از کتابخانه های پایتون مانند Scikit و Tensorflow متفاوت است. او عاشق ساختن رابط کاربری و ارائه تجربیات کاربری خوب است.
نمایش نظرات